Why is strategic management important?
A. It has little impact on organizational performance
B. It is involved in many of the decisions that managers make
C. Most organizations do not change
D. Organizations are composed of similar divisions and functions
Answer: Option B
Solution (By Examveda Team)
Strategic management important because It is involved in many of the decisions that managers make. It acts as a foundation for all key decisions of the firm.
